Viewer Advisory Issued for Upcoming “General Hospital” Episodes Due to California Wildfires

News RoomBy News RoomJanuary 9, 2025
Share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Telegram Email WhatsApp Copy Link

Paragraph 1: The Intersection of Real-Life Tragedy and Fictional Drama

The popular daytime soap opera, General Hospital, found itself in a delicate position in January 2025 when real-life events mirrored a sensitive storyline. As wildfires ravaged Los Angeles County, forcing evacuations and impacting numerous residents, including celebrities, the show was airing episodes depicting a fiery explosion that severely injured a main character. Recognizing the potential distress this could cause viewers grappling with the real-world disaster, General Hospital issued a preemptive warning on social media, advising viewers that the upcoming episodes might be too difficult to watch for some, given the current circumstances. This sensitive approach acknowledged the emotional impact of the wildfires and demonstrated respect for the audience’s well-being.

Paragraph 2: The Departure of a Beloved Character: Chad Duell’s Exit

The storyline at the center of this sensitive situation involved long-time character Michael Corinthos, played by actor Chad Duell for over 14 years. The narrative depicted Michael being caught in an explosion and suffering severe burns, a traumatic sequence that aired amidst the real-life backdrop of the Los Angeles wildfires. Adding another layer of complexity, Duell’s portrayal of Michael was coming to an end, as the actor had announced his departure from the show two months prior to the airing of these intense scenes. Duell shared his decision on social media in November 2024, expressing gratitude for his time on the show but indicating a need for personal growth and change. He framed his exit not as a final goodbye but as a "see you later," suggesting the possibility of a future return.

Paragraph 3: Personal Reasons Behind the Departure

Duell’s decision to leave General Hospital wasn’t solely driven by professional ambitions. In a December 2024 podcast interview, he revealed that several personal factors contributed to his choice. The recent passing of his father had deeply affected him, and he expressed a desire to prioritize his family, including his partner, Luana Lucci, and their young son, Dawson. He spoke about the need to spend more time with his loved ones and to focus on personal healing and growth during this challenging period. These revelations provided context to his departure, highlighting the importance of personal well-being and family in his life.

Paragraph 4: Seeking Personal Growth and Redefining Identity

Duell further elaborated on his motivations, explaining that his long tenure on General Hospital had led to a strong identification with his character, Michael Corinthos. He felt that this had, in some ways, limited his personal growth and exploration. Leaving the show, he acknowledged, was a necessary step to break free from this comfortable but potentially confining identity and discover who he truly was outside of the role that had defined him for so long. This journey of self-discovery involved embracing discomfort and challenging himself to reach his full potential, both personally and professionally.

Paragraph 5: The Emotional Toll of Long-Term Roles

Duell’s experience highlights the potential emotional impact of playing a character for an extended period. He recognized that his sense of self had become intertwined with Michael Corinthos, and untangling this connection required a significant life adjustment. He expressed a need to "unravel" his identity and explore different facets of himself, which involved embracing the unknown and stepping outside his comfort zone. This candid reflection on the challenges of leaving a long-term role resonated with many actors and viewers who understand the complexities of separating oneself from a character they have embodied for years.

Paragraph 6: The Show Must Go On – Viewing Options and Future Directions

Despite the real-world events and the departure of a key cast member, General Hospital continued its broadcast schedule, airing weekdays on ABC and offering streaming access on Hulu. The show’s sensitive handling of the wildfire situation and Duell’s departure demonstrated a commitment to both its viewers and its actors. While Duell’s future plans remained open-ended, he expressed a desire to explore new opportunities and challenge himself creatively. His departure marked a significant transition for both the actor and the show, leaving fans to speculate about the future direction of Michael Corinthos’s storyline and anticipating Duell’s next career move.
